Job Detail

Front-End Developer at SoFi
San Francisco, CA, US
Description
About the Role

By joining SoFi, you're joining a new kind of finance company based around speed, transparency, and alignment with our members’ interests. Our goal is to be the center of our members’ financial lives. We created student loan refinancing, addressing the biggest financial challenge this new generation has through a new approach to lending. We expanded into other types of loans, and then into insurance and wealth management with similarly inventive products. As the company has grown, we’ve been able to help more people with these tools.

SoFi has achieved significant growth, with big plans ahead. In just the last year, we've more than doubled our member base (260,000 strong), doubled loan volume ($8 billion in 2016), and grown our team from under 200 people to more than 900. We're preparing to go global, with expansion to Australia and Canada planned this year. And we're well capitalized to power all this growth, having raised $1.9 billion in equity backing. But we'll only be able to continue this growth with great talent, and that includes you.

Do you love creating innovative, dynamic web solutions? Want to experiment with the latest CSS3 styles such as flexbox and animation? Hate having to support IE10 and other old browsers?

SoFi is looking for a full-time Front-End Developer who can work closely together with our designers and engineers to turn conceptual visual designs into efficient, dynamic, and standards-compliant websites. Your work will directly benefit our members by helping them to achieve their goals and change their financial lives for the better. This is an exciting opportunity to join one of the fastest growing fintech companies in the Bay Area focused on disrupting a huge industry.

About You

You enjoy a challenge and love to tinker and experiment. You are always on the lookout to discover new and more optimal solutions instead of just sticking with what may have worked in the past but you are still able to be pragmatic and realistic about business needs. You care about creating innovative and responsive websites. You aren't rooted to a particular framework (or any) but are flexible and willing to use the best tool to get the job done. You are renowned for your attention to detail.

Must Have

· Experience with client-side JavaScript frameworks (ex. Angular, Angular 2, React, etc.)

· Ability to develop JavaScript front-end components

· Ability to distill visual designs into design patterns using extensible and reusable CSS

· Responsive design/development and mobile web best practices experience

· Some CSS meta-language experience such as with Sass or Less (We use Sass)

· Basic cross-browser testing and trouble shooting experience

· Some experience with version control tools such as Git or SVN (We use Git)

· Ability to brainstorm with other team members and deal with constructive feedback

When applying, please provide A URL or code sample demonstrating the best of your JS and/or CSS & HTML coding ability.

Nice to Have

· A background in design or appreciation of good design and UX

· Knowledge of TypeScript

· Experience with using a living style guide

· MySQL and Postgres

· CSS framework familiarity

This is a great opportunity for engineering professionals looking to join an emerging leader that’s focused on disrupting a huge industry. If you’re a good fit, please send us your resume and a link to your portfolio. We look forward to hearing from you.

Benefits

· Catered lunches, a fully stocked kitchen, and subsidized gym membership.

· Competitive salary packages and bonuses.

· A flexible vacation policy allows you to truly relax and reboot.

· Comprehensive health, vision, dental, and life insurance as well as disability benefits.

· 100% of health, vision, and dental premiums paid by SoFi for employees and their dependents.

· 401(k) and education on retirement planning.

· Tuition reimbursement on approved programs, up to $5,250 a year.

· Monthly contribution to help you pay off your student loans.